He It Is

“Praise the Lord!
Praise the name of the Lord,
    give praise, O servants of the Lord,
who stand in the house of the Lord,
    in the courts of the house of our God!
Praise the Lord, for the Lord is good;
    sing to his name, for it is pleasant!

For I know that the Lord is great,
    and that our Lord is above all gods.
Whatever the Lord pleases, he does,
    in heaven and on earth,
    in the seas and all deeps.
He it is who makes the clouds rise at the end of the earth,
    who makes lightnings for the rain
    and brings forth the wind from his storehouses.

Your name, O Lord, endures forever,
    your renown, O Lord, throughout all ages.
For the Lord will vindicate his people
    and have compassion on his servants.”
Psalm 135:1-3,5-7,13-14

“He is the radiance of the glory of God and the exact imprint of his nature, and he upholds the universe by the word of his power.” Hebrews 1:3

He it is, the pre-existent One, infinitely before and Cause and End of all creation, who set His affection on us and saved us. This was not because of what we had done, but because of who He is, the merciful Redeemer. He it is who ignites our hearts with His radiance and our lips to sing to His name. (Deuteronomy 7:7-8; John 1:1-3; Colossians 1:15-17; Titus 3:5; Hebrews 1:10-12)

We have every reason to praise the LORD. His name that is above every name is good, excellent, beautiful, and holy, to be voiced with reverence and awe. He is sovereign King whose throne cannot be shaken, and great High Priest, sufficient and supreme for and above His creation. He is superior to all gods, the Lord of lords, ineffably sublime. His providence is loving and sure. His power and creativity are infinite. His renown is limitless and untouchable. Yes, He it is who is worthy of praise. (Deuteronomy 10:17; Philippians 2:9-11; Hebrews 4:14; 12:28-29)

We have every reason to trust the LORD. He is supreme, excellent and perfect in His ways. What He plans is redemptive and for our hope, and He always does what He says He will. His rule and justice are eternal and consistent with His righteous pleasure. He is unique in His divinity, and always prepares and works good for His children. He is for us, our Defender and Advocate, our Shield and great reward. Yes, He it is who is worthy of our trust. (Genesis 15:1; Isaiah 46:9-11; Jeremiah 29:11; Romans 8:28-34)

We have every reason to serve the LORD. He owns the house, He rules the courts, and He is a good and compassionate Master. He has freed us from slavery to sin to be His willing and privileged servants. We serve Him by serving others in His name. Yes, He it is who is worthy of our service. (Matthew 25:40; Romans 6:20-22; Galatians 5:13)

We have every reason to love the LORD. None cherishes us like He. His love is everlasting, His grace and kindness unmatched. He made us in His image and for His glory, and gave His life for ours. Would we not give ours and all our affection for and to Him? Yes, He it is who is worthy of our love. (Genesis 1:27; Isaiah 43:3-7; Jeremiah 31:3; John 15:13)

Resplendent LORD God, You alone are worthy of my full allegiance and adoration. Keep me praising You all the day and night, with the honor You deserve.
